Indeed this was also my #1 mistake and the #1 I see from so many startups learning to go upmarket. You have to be careful to pair that with someone strong to manage the relationship, that has more time and that also can be trusted. As a founder, you’ll just run out of time to properly manage key customers and partners yourself.
